New rapid tests could uncover hidden chagas infections in argentina

NCT ID NCT07304349

First seen Jan 06, 2026 · Last updated May 08, 2026 · Updated 18 times

Summary

This study aims to see if simple, rapid blood tests can accurately detect chronic Chagas disease in public health clinics across Argentina. Many people with Chagas don't know they have it because standard testing is slow and requires special labs. Researchers will test over 3,200 people, including pregnant women and blood donors, to find the best way to diagnose the disease quickly and start treatment sooner.
